【摘要】:Creep-fatiguecrackgrowthtestingistypicallyperformedatelevatedtemperaturesoverarangeoffrequenciesandhold-timesandinvolvesthesequentialorsimultaneousapplicationoftheloadingconditionsnecessarytogeneratecracktipcyclicdeformation/damageenhancedbycreepdeformation/damageorviceversa.Unlesssuchtestsareperformedinvacuumoraninertenvironment,oxidationcanalsoberesponsibleforimportantinteractioneffectsrelatingtodamageaccumulation.Thepurposeofcreep-fatiguecrackgrowthtestscanbetodeterminematerialpropertydatafor(a)assessmentinputdataforthedamageconditionanalysisofengineeringstructuresoperatingatelevatedtemperatures,(b)materialcharacterization,or(c)developmentandverificationofrulesfordesignandlifeassessmentofhigh-temperaturecomponentssubjecttocyclicservicewithlowfrequenciesorwithperiodsofsteadyoperation,oracombinationthereof.Ineverycase,itisadvisabletohavecomplementarycontinuouscyclingfatiguedata(gatheredatthesameloading/unloadingrate),creepcrackgrowthdataforthesamematerialandtesttemperature(s)asperTestMethodE1457,andcreep-fatiguecrackformationdataasperTestMethodE2714.Aggressiveenvironmentsathightemperaturescansignificantlyaffectthecreep-fatiguecrackgrowthbehavior.Attentionmustbegiventotheproperselectionandcontroloftemperatureandenvironmentinresearchstudiesandingenerationofdesigndata.Resultsfromthistestmethodcanbeusedasfollows:Establishmaterialselectioncriteriaandinspectionrequirementsfordamagetolerantapplicationswherecyclicloadingatelevatedtemperatureispresent.Establish,inquantitativeterms,theindividualandcombinedeffectsofmetallurgical,fabrication,operatingtemperature,andloadingvariablesoncreep-fatiguecrackgrowthlife.Theresultsobtainedfromthistestmethodaredesignedforcrackdominantregimesofcreep-fatiguefailureandshouldnotbeappliedtocracksinstructureswithwide-spreadcreepdamage.Localizeddamageinasmallzonearoundthecracktipispermissible,butnotinazonethatiscomparableinsizetothecracksizeortheremainingligamentsize.1.1Thistestmethodcoversthedeterminationofcreep-fatiguecrackgrowthpropertiesofnominallyhomogeneousmaterialsbyuseofpre-crackedcompacttype,C(T),testspecimenssubjectedtouniaxialcyclicforces.Itconcernsfatiguecyclingwithsufficientlylongloading/unloadingratesorhold-times,orboth,tocausecreepdeformationatthecracktipandthecreepdeformationberesponsibleforenhancedcrackgrowthperloadingcycle.Itisintendedasaguideforcreep-fatiguetestingperformedinsupportofsuchactivitiesasmaterialsresearchanddevelopment,mechanicaldesign,processandqualitycontrol,productperformance,andfailureanalysis.Therefore,thismethodrequirestestingofatleasttwospecimensthatyieldoverlappingcrackgrowthratedata.Thecyclicconditionsresponsibleforcreep-fatiguedeformationandenhancedcrackgrowthvarywithmaterialandwithtemperatureforagivenmaterial.Theeffectsofenvironmentsuchastime-dependentoxidationinenhancingthecrackgrowthratesareassumedtobeincludedinthetestresults;itisthusessentialtoconducttestinginanenvironmentthatisrepresentativeoftheintendedapplication.1.2Twotypesofcrackgrowthmechanismsareobservedduringcreep/fatiguetests:(1)time-dependentintergranularcreepand(2)cycledependenttransgranularfatigu......
